Machine learning model to predict vaccine dropout risk (DTP1–DTP3) across African countries using immunization and demographic data. # Vax Track AI - Vaccine Dropout Prediction This project develops a machine learning model to predict vaccine dropout risk (DTP1–DTP3) across African countries using immunization and demographic data. It also includes an interactive **Streamlit app** for real-time predictions. Live Deployment: Streamlit App --- ## 🚀 Features - Preprocessing pipeline with scaling, encoding, and SMOTE for class balance - Models trained with **Logistic Regression, Random Forest, SVM, and XGBoost** using GridSearchCV - Automatic region selection when a user chooses a country - Streamlit dashboard with metric cards (**Dropout Rate, Coverage Average, DTP3 Coverage**) - Visualizations including boxplots and interactive charts --- ## 📂 Project Structure ```bash ├── data/ # Raw and processed datasets ├── notebooks/ # Jupyter notebooks for exploration & training ├── app/ # Streamlit app │ ├── app.py │ └── utils.py ├── models/ # Saved models and preprocessing pipelines ├── requirements.txt # Python dependencies └── README.md # Project documentation ``` ## ⚙️ Installation Clone this repo: ```bash git clone github.com cd vaccine-dropout-prediction ``` Create and activate a virtual environment: ```bash python -m venv venv source venv/bin/activate # On Windows: venv\Scripts\activate ``` Install dependencies: ```bash pip install -r requirements.txt ``` ## ▶️ Usage ### Run Streamlit app ```bash streamlit run app/app.py ``` ## 📊 Example App View - Metric cards for Dropout Rate, Coverage Average, DTP3 Coverage - Country & region selection with automatic region mapping - Prediction probability shown with visual feedback ## 📌 Future Improvements - Deploy on Streamlit Cloud or Azure Web App - Add additional health & socioeconomic predictors - Expand dataset beyond Africa
